    I like to see independent testing against the other 6mm cartridges and see ballistics comparisons.

    I'm all for new cartridges, but I want to see how it stacks up against other cartridges and what does it offer that we don't have already.

    I would too.

    AR calibers are a tough market now. There are so many of them and the market is so saturated that most will fail. I will be interested to see how this does and how it actually stacks up against other AR long range rounds, not just 6mm ones. I doubt this will do much against the 6.5 Grendel, but it might cause the 224 Valkyrie to lose traction and possibly even cause it to be dropped altogether.

    I hope not.
    For those like me that have bad joints, the .224 Valkyrie is a great round. It will reach out well past a .223/5.56 and not beat my shoulder up. Plus I can use mostly the same reloading components, other than brass, for both.
    The only other round I have shot that doesn't hurt that will let me shoot over 100 a day is 6.5 Grendel. And only suppressed. I don't have a suppressor. It was a friends.
